Just like any previous end-of-years, I would look at my journals again, tracking what's up and where life had taken and guided me, what has made me feel good, what has made me down. Lately I tend to write "current state of spirit:" at the beginning of each entry (describing what I feel at that time of writing) then under that line i would list anything what I did, what I read, what I ate, what I heard, etc, before that. Sometimes just by looking at the list I could instantly evaluate the process. After awhile I noticed that (for example) I would feel happier in the morning when I woke up early - or event what kind of pens that made my handwritings look better :-D

That, I have no doubt saying it now, is the kind of journal that I really like. Now that it's time to evaluate, I found it very helpful when it comes to making plans for 2010. Focus on what makes you feel good and happy. I can complain about too much work but I can focus instead on the fact that I have an exciting and rewarding job. That needs a constant practice :-)

And here's a little instruction on how to install the background (the background works best with Minima template):
  1. Copy the code from one of the boxes below
  2. Log in to your blogger account, open the dashbord and click on LAYOUT
  3. Click on PAGE ELEMENT, the "Add and Arrange Page Elements" will open
  4. Click on ADD A GADGET
  5. When a window with list of gadgets opens, choose 'HTML/JavaScript'
  6. Paste the HTML code into the box and click save
  7. Enjoy! (and let me know what you think if you use them :-))
